The Model 690 is one sharp knife on both ends. This Allen Elishewitz design pulls out all the stops in knife making.
Black carbon fiber and rose color stabilized wood are delicately fashioned into a multi-contoured specimen of hand tantalizing grip. Add to that, sapphire-blue anodized double titanium liners with patented modified locking-liner. Bolt on a two-toned custom finish blade shaped for maximum utility.
Convenient carry is offered with use of the Elishewitz tear-drop signature carry-clip, or it can easily be removed if desired.
Specifications:
Blade Length:
3.25 in.
Blade Shape:
Clip Point
Blade Steel:
154CM
Clip:
Silver Tear-Drop, Removable, Tip-Down
Handle Material:
Black Carbon Fiber & Stabilized Rose Wood Scales
Knife Type:
Folding
Length Closed:
4.12 in.
Length Overall:
7.5 in.
Weight:
3.0 oz.

About Benchmade
Benchmade Knife Company, Inc. set-up shop in Clackamas, Oregon in 1990 (originally founded in California in 1988). The initial knives primarily consisted of the Bali-Song knives, using a combination of outside vendors and inside processing to build finished products. And like most companies, starting out meant scarce money and big plans, using second hand equipment and limited resources.
Soon, a natural born fortitude and an undying passion to make it right and make it Benchmade, prospered into significant growth. As the product line grew so did the in-house capabilities. Benchmade began to acquire new machines and technologies including the first of several lasers, making Benchmade the first knife manufacturer to have such equipment in-house. Open minds and positive attitudes would lead to several more industry firsts over the course of the next several years.
This was only the beginning of Benchmade's breaking of new ground in the manufactured knife markets by using non-traditional materials and modern manufacturing methods in not only building knives better but, inevitably building better knives. The Designer Series was first introduced in 1991 with several custom designs being manufactured. By tapping into the custom knife makers' knowledge and combining it with our manufacturing expertise we were more readily able to offer more contemporary knife designs and innovations to the knife users.
Consecutive years of aggressive growth led to the next logical step in 1996 when Benchmade moved into its own 35,000 sq. ft. facility. A contemporary styled building complete with all of the modern equipment and amenities necessary to manufacture what has become recognized as a higher standard of specialty cutlery.
Today, Benchmade Knife Company, Inc. manufactures knives for a loyal and ever growing following of knife users.
